Rancho Urgent Care is an urgent care center located at 7777 Milliken Ave Rancho Cucamonga, CA 91730 . This provider is open 7 days a week.

Rancho Urgent Care, located within the Rancho San Antonio Medical Plaza, offers urgent care and walk-in clinic services specializing in non-life-threatening medical concerns, including pediatric urgent care. The center emphasizes convenient access to care through online appointment scheduling and walk-in availability. Rancho Urgent Care operates under the broader mission and values of San Antonio Regional Hospital, which is committed to improving patient health and well-being by providing safe, high-quality, and compassionate care. The practice prioritizes patient partnership, safety, integrity, excellence, compassion, and respect. It accepts a variety of insurance plans (though specifics are not detailed in the text) and serves the Inland Empire community. The facility is part of a network including additional medical plazas and urgent care centers, supporting comprehensive and accessible healthcare services.

What is an urgent care center?

Urgent care centers are type of walk-in clinic open beyond typical office hours. Urgent care clinics offer a broader scope of services compared to many primary care providers.

Unlike emergency rooms urgent care centers are not open 24 hours a day. Urgent care is for injuries that are severe enough to require immediate attention, but typically not life-threatening. For more serious injuries or emergencies, it’s best to call 911 or head to the emergency room.

You should go to an urgent care center when your injury or ailment is not that severe, and you can head to your nearest urgent care center.

You will find that urgent care centers costs are much more reasonable and the level of service and wait times are far superior to the average emergency room.
